The California Continuation Education Association (CCEA) is sponsoring legislation this session to both provide a minimum level of funding for continuation high schools and link increased funding to meeting certain standards of quality. Assembly Member Jackie Goldberg (D-Los Angeles) has agreed to carry the bill for the Association and Los Angeles Unified School District will be co-sponsoring the legislation. We are urging all members of CCEA to contact their local legislators urging them to become co-authors of the bill. Specifically the legislation is attempting to provide a minimum level of funding for those school districts which are currently receiving less than $1,500 in continuation high school funding per continuation high school ADA.
